GitHub是一个开放的代码托管平台,用户可以在上面找到并下载各种类型的代码项目。其中,Ninja项目因其强大的功能和高效的性能而受到许多开发者的青睐。在这篇文章中,我们将深入探讨如何在GitHub上下载Ninja项目,包括所需的步骤、技巧,以及常见问题解答。
什么是Ninja?
Ninja是一款小型的构建系统,旨在提高编译速度。与其他构建工具相比,Ninja采用了简单高效的设计理念,能够在大型项目中显著提高构建速度。许多开发者在进行项目开发时都会选择使用Ninja作为其构建工具。
为何要从GitHub下载Ninja?
从GitHub下载Ninja项目有多种好处:
- 获取最新代码:在GitHub上,你可以获得Ninja项目的最新版本和最新功能。
- 社区支持:GitHub是一个活跃的社区,开发者们可以在这里提出问题、解决bug,甚至贡献代码。
- 版本控制:通过Git,你可以轻松管理不同版本的Ninja项目。
如何在GitHub上下载Ninja?
第一步:访问GitHub网站
打开浏览器,访问GitHub官网。在搜索框中输入“Ninja”,并找到相应的项目。
第二步:找到正确的项目
- 在搜索结果中,选择由Google开发的Ninja项目(通常是第一个结果)。
- 点击进入项目主页,你将看到项目的详细信息和代码结构。
第三步:选择下载方式
Ninja项目的下载方式主要有两种:
-
Clone:如果你希望将整个项目复制到本地并进行开发,可以使用Git Clone命令。
bash git clone https://github.com/ninja-build/ninja.git -
Download ZIP:如果你只想快速下载项目的代码,可以选择下载ZIP文件。
- 点击“Code”按钮,然后选择“Download ZIP”。
第四步:解压文件
如果你选择了下载ZIP文件,完成下载后,右键点击文件并选择“解压缩”或使用相应的解压软件解压文件。
下载Ninja项目后怎么办?
一旦你成功下载了Ninja项目,接下来你需要:
- 阅读项目文档:项目通常会包含README文件,里面有使用说明和安装步骤。
- 安装依赖项:根据项目要求,可能需要安装特定的依赖库。
- 编译项目:如果你下载的是源代码,通常需要使用Ninja进行编译。
bash cd ninja ./configure.py ninja
常见问题解答
1. GitHub上的Ninja项目安全吗?
是的,GitHub上的大多数开源项目经过社区的审查,相对安全。但在下载和使用前,最好检查一下项目的活跃度和更新频率。
2. 如何找到最新的Ninja版本?
在GitHub项目主页,你可以查看“Releases”标签页,里面列出了所有发布的版本和相应的更新日志。
3. 我可以贡献代码到Ninja项目吗?
当然可以!Ninja是一个开源项目,欢迎开发者贡献代码。通常需要先Fork项目,修改后提交Pull Request。
4. 下载Ninja项目时遇到错误怎么办?
如果在下载或使用Ninja时遇到问题,可以查看项目主页的“Issues”标签,许多常见问题已经在这里得到了解答。
5. 是否需要安装Git才能下载Ninja?
如果你选择使用Clone方式,则需要安装Git。但如果选择下载ZIP文件,则不需要。
结论
下载Ninja项目在GitHub上非常简单,用户只需按照上述步骤即可顺利获取代码。希望这篇文章能帮助你更好地理解如何下载和使用Ninja项目,并解决相关问题。如果你有任何问题,欢迎在GitHub上与我们交流。